Room controller returns to default setpoints

To eliminate the waste of energy caused by the settings of room controllers being changed by building occupants, C Squared has developed the iTSP — an intelligent BACnet room sensor with adjustable setpoint/auto reset to factory default after a default or preselected time period to comply with the requirements of the scheme for Enhanced Capital Allowances.

This intelligent sensor has BACnet communication, so it can be reset by a BACnet BMS controller.
